Output 5177eea90d51e30ef9c265c0cef504120fbde9c7cd1877a100fafda7594e5b33:4

value
266676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3272ed6fc6114775eecdddcd2e39e666ab8dafb1 OP_EQUAL
address
36HmPSJUzBw86YCAaP5Nwz54r5g2ncuyfR
transaction
5177eea90d51e30ef9c265c0cef504120fbde9c7cd1877a100fafda7594e5b33
spent
true